Clinical Midwife – Lactation Consultant
Join the Mount Isa Hospital Maternity Service as a Clinical Midwife – Lactation Consultant, where you'll provide specialist, evidence‐based infant feeding support while leading clinical practice, education and quality improvement across a busy regional maternity service. This is a pivotal role supporting women, families and clinicians across the continuum of care.
About the Role
Play a key leadership role within the Mount Isa Hospital Midwifery Service, delivering specialised lactation and infant feeding care to women and their families across inpatient, outpatient and outreach settings. Working autonomously and collaboratively, you'll promote best practice, support complex feeding needs, and contribute to achieving Baby Friendly Hospital Initiative (BFHI) accreditation, while mentoring and guiding the broader maternity team.
* Provide expert lactation and infant feeding support, using evidence‐based practice to care for women and babies with both routine and complex needs across the maternity continuum.
* Lead and influence clinical practice, offering advanced clinical decision‐making, mentorship and support to midwives, nurses and students within the service.
* Drive quality, education and improvement initiatives, including BFHI standards, clinical audits, data collection and service development activities.
